"If I Can Stay Sober, Anybody Can." And He Means It.
"I'm seeing the world with new eyes. I'm thinking with a new brain."
That's Ben M. now. We first met him in 2024, three and a half years sober, and his story stopped us cold. The only boy in a big Hispanic family in El Paso. The fox on the way to school. The law license he lost. The psych ward he woke up in twice in one week. The single glass of wine on a flight to San Francisco that undid everything. We called that episode Triumph Over Trials. It became one of the most popular episodes we've ever done.
Now Ben's back. Over six years sober. And the difference between then and now is something we think you need to hear.
